New design method of space-frequency coding and fast detection algorithm

description | To analyze the performance of space-frequency codes,the Chernoff bound was used in the existing literatures,but it was too loose to conclude the diversity order and coding gain simultaneously.Therefore,a new view of the transmission of space-frequency codes was addressed,which transformed the transmission in frequency selective channels into flat fading channels.Based on this transformation,the performance analysis of space-time coding in flat fading channels was used to present an asymptotic analysis for the performance of space-frequency coding.Then,the design criterion of the full diver-sity-achieving space-frequency code was concluded and the coding gain was also optimized.The analysis was more univer-sal and owned an intelligible comprehension.It integrated the existing analysis of the space-frequency codes.A fast detection algorithm for the code was also proposed.It exploited the trellis decoding method and had a reduced complexity compared with the ML detection.The simulation results confirm the validity of the design criterion. |
